Understand your SLAs and set clear metrics
To effectively track SLAs, it’s essential to first have a thorough understanding of the agreements in place. This means defining the specific services, performance expectations, and timeframes for delivery that each SLA covers. According to a 2021 survey, 57% of organizations struggle with vague SLAs, leading to miscommunication and unmet expectations. Property investors and landlords should ensure that each SLA includes clear, measurable metrics that can be tracked within SINGU FM.
For example, SLAs should include response times for maintenance requests, availability of key facilities, or the condition of specific assets. With SINGU FM, you can input and track these metrics in real-time, allowing you to monitor compliance against the agreed service levels. By doing so, landlords and property managers can quickly identify underperforming contractors or areas that require improvement.

Leverage data insights for better decision-making
SINGU FM’s analytics features offer a wealth of data that can be used to improve asset SLA tracking. The software’s reporting tools provide a detailed overview of asset performance, SLA compliance, and contractor efficiency. Using these insights, landlords and property investors can make data-driven decisions to enhance operational efficiency.
For instance, by reviewing historical SLA data, you can identify patterns of non-compliance or recurring issues with specific contractors or assets, where SLA standards are not being met. If a particular asset frequently fails to meet performance benchmarks, it may indicate the need for replacement or an adjustment to the service level expectations. Similarly, identifying contractors who consistently meet or exceed SLA standards can inform future contract negotiations, allowing you to prioritize working with high-performing service providers.
